A leading investment research firm is looking for an Associate Sub-editor to join their new German language Editorial team. This role requires native fluency in German and English, along with a passion for financial content and at least 2 years of experience in editing or proofreading.
Responsibilities include:
- Reviewing transcripts for accuracy
- Refining AI-generated translations
- Helping to set guidelines for the team as it grows
The position offers a transparent bonus structure, generous vacation time, and opportunities for personal development.
